BEVERLY HILLS, March 26, (THEWILL) – The people of Borno State and Nigerians at large have been urged to remain calm and be peaceful during the general elections starting on Saturday.

Making this call on Thursday was the Shehu of Borno, Alhaji Abubakar Umar Garbai El-Kanemi, who also called for efforts to ensuring the success of the polls.

Maintaining that “What peace does not achieved, violence and intolerance cannot achieve,” the Borno monarch called on all politicians to preach the gospel of peace and eschew all forms of bitterness.

He urged them to consider the unity, peace and progress of the entire nation as paramount that cannot be compromised for any political or selfish gains.

The Shehu of Borno, while stressing that the state and Nigeria as a whole is undergoing a trying period in its history, urged the need to focus on issues that will bring about lasting peace, unity and stability.

Advising the youth as generation of future leaders of the country not to allow themselves to be used as political tools to create havoc or destruction, the monarch Called for prayers for peace in the State and Nigeria.
